Join us for a conversation on current relations between the United States and China and possible paths forward given COVID and the upcoming U.S. elections. Panelists will include Mary Gallagher, professor of political science, Kenneth Lieberthal, senior fellow emeritus at Brookings, and Ann Lin, associate professor of public policy. Ford School Dean Michael Barr will moderate the discussion. 

This event is sponsored by the Ford School and co-sponsored by the Lieberthal-Rogel Center for Chinese Studies, the International Institute, and the Weiser Diplomacy Center. It is also part of the U-M Pan Asia Alumni Reunion.
